如何在阿里云上使用WordPress进行网站搭建
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
首先,请确保您的阿里云服务器已经正确配置并启动。通过SSH连接到您的服务器,并使用FTP客户端(如FileZilla)上传WordPress文件到服务器上的指定目录。,,在服务器控制面板中,创建一个新的WordPress网站。选择合适的主题和插件,然后填写必要的信息以完成安装过程。您需要拥有足够的权限来访问服务器并执行这些操作。,,在完成安装后,您可以开始设置WordPress并进行进一步的定制工作。建议定期备份您的网站数据以防万一。,,通过遵循上述步骤,您可以轻松地将WordPress部署到阿里云虚拟主机上。
随着互联网的发展和人们对个性化、便捷信息获取的需求增加,越来越多的人开始使用WordPress来创建自己的个人或企业网站,对于初学者来说,如何在阿里云上设置一个稳定的WordPress环境可能会感到有些困难,本文将为您提供详细的步骤指南,帮助您轻松地安装并配置WordPress在阿里云的虚拟主机上。
第一步:注册阿里云账户
如果您还没有阿里云账户,请前往 [阿里云官网](https://www.aliyun.com/) 注册一个新的账号,确保选择适合您的地区和套餐。
第二步:购买阿里云服务器
登录到您的阿里云账户后,点击右上角的“控制台”,然后导航到“计算”->“云服务器ECS”,点击“立即购买”按钮,根据需要选择合适的配置(如CPU核心数、内存大小等),然后完成支付流程,完成后,等待服务器的启动过程,通常几分钟内就可以看到服务已经激活了。
第三步:选择阿里云提供的WordPress VPS
阿里云提供了多种类型的VPS,包括标准型、高性能型和增强型,您可以根据自己的需求选择合适的配置,我们推荐使用阿里云提供的WordPress VPS实例,这些实例经过优化,非常适合运行WordPress和其他轻量级应用。
第四步:通过SSH访问服务器
在阿里云管理控制台上找到你的新服务器,并点击进入,这里会显示一些基本的信息,如IP地址、操作系统等,你需要通过SSH(Secure Shell)命令行连接到你的服务器,你可以从阿里云控制面板中下载并安装PuTTY或其他SSH客户端软件,或者直接使用浏览器中的SSH工具进行连接,输入服务器的IP地址和默认的SSH端口号(通常是22),然后按照提示输入用户名和密码(一般为root或通过阿里云控制面板设置的自定义密码),一旦成功连接,你就可以开始配置服务器了。
第五步:安装MySQL数据库
由于WordPress依赖于MySQL数据库,因此在安装WordPress之前,我们需要先设置好MySQL数据库,打开终端窗口,输入以下命令:
sudo yum install mysql-server -y
这将会自动安装MySQL服务及其相关组件,之后,启动并启用MySQL服务:
sudo systemctl start mysqld sudo systemctl enable mysqld
第六步:创建数据库和用户
登录到MySQL控制台,执行以下SQL命令来创建新的数据库和用户:
CREATE DATABASE wordpress_db; C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password'; GRANT ALL PRIVILEGES ON wordpress_db.* TO 'your_username'@'localhost'; FLUSH PRIVILEGES; EXIT;
请替换your_username
和your_password
为你实际使用的用户名和密码。
第七步:配置Apache Web服务器
现在我们可以配置Apache Web服务器来托管WordPress站点,编辑Apache配置文件以允许外部访问:
sudo vi /etc/httpd/conf/httpd.conf
在文件末尾添加如下行:
Listen 80 <Directory "/var/www/html"> Options Indexes FollowSymLinks AllowOverride All </Directory>
保存并退出编辑器,然后重启Apache服务:
sudo systemctl restart httpd
第八步:安装PHP和WordPress
继续在终端窗口中,输入以下命令安装所需的PHP扩展:
sudo yum install php php-mysqlnd php-gd php-curl php-xml php-zip php-bcmath -y
上传WordPress官方的压缩包到服务器上的指定目录:
cd /var/www/html/ sudo wget https://wordpress.org/latest.tar.gz tar xzf latest.tar.gz
更改目录权限,以便Apache可以读取:
sudo chown -R apache:apache /var/www/html/wordpress
在主Apache配置文件中修改DocumentRoot和ServerName设置:
<VirtualHost *:80> ServerAdmin webmaster@example.com DocumentRoot "/var/www/html/wordpress" ServerName your_domain_name_or_ip ErrorLog "logs/your_domain_name_or_ip_error.log" CustomLog "logs/your_domain_name_or_ip_access.log" combined </VirtualHost>
注意,这里的your_domain_name_or_ip
应该替换为您想要用于WordPress的域名或IP地址。
第九步:创建数据库表和用户
在Wordpress根目录下,使用phpMyAdmin或直接用SQL命令来创建WordPress的数据库表和用户:
USE wordpress_db; CREATE TABLE wp_users ( ID int(11) NOT NULL AUTO_INCREMENT, user_login varchar(64) DEFAULT '' NOT NULL, user_pass varchar(255) NOT NULL, user_nicename varchar(50) NOT NULL, user_email varchar(100) NOT NULL, user_url varchar(100) NOT NULL, user_registered datetime NOT NULL, user_activation_key varchar(60) NOT NULL, user_status tinyint(1) NOT NULL, display_name varchar(50) NOT NULL, PRIMARY KEY (ID) );
第十步:启动WordPress安装向导
您可以通过浏览器访问您的域名,按页面指示进行WordPress安装,如果一切顺利,您将能够创建一个全新的WordPress网站。
就是我们在阿里云上安装和配置WordPress的一般步骤,这个过程相对简单,但需要注意的是,为了保证安全性和稳定性,建议定期备份您的数据,并保持对系统更新的关注,如果您在过程中遇到任何问题,欢迎随时联系阿里云技术支持团队寻求帮助,祝您成功!